LEAMINGTON 0-1 MARINE

Leamington 0-1 Marine; Enterprise NLN Saturday 8th November 2025

Max Ledson reports from Your Co-Op Community Stadium

Marine defeated a struggling Leamington side on Saturday to claim their fifth away win of the season.

The away side started the game strongly and put Leamington under pressure right from the off.

The Mariners early pressure led to a goal in the 10th minute after a corner found its way back out wide to Fin Sinclair-Smith, who whipped the ball back into the area and found Adam Anson who glanced the header past Rogan Ravenhill in the Leamington goal.

After taking the lead Marine were comfortable in defending the few chances created by the home side and went into the break with the lead after a dominant performance.

The second half continued in the same way with the Mariners comfortable in sitting back and hitting the home side on the counter with great success.

The Brakes were the masters of their own downfall in the second half with misplaced passes often ending their attacks before they’d even started.

A standout player in the second half was Bailey Marsden for Marine who had the best chance of the half in the 70th minute after a fast counter attack ended with him at the top of the Leamington penalty area, however, his shot was just wide of the post.

It was a comfortable performance in the end for the Mariners who will hope to turn their away form into home form with three games in a row at the MTA to follow.
